Analysis The Influence Factor Of Lateral Rotation Angle In Salter Innominate Osteotomy(SIO)

Objective:objective to the effect of desceding angle of distal iliac on the acetabulum after salter innominate osteotomy.Materials and methods:selected 82 hips in 64 patients who underwent SIO for the treatment of DDH,the age of patients was between 14-66 month old;Preoperative radiographs including acetabular index(AI),acetabular index of depth(AID),acetabular index of width(AIW).And postoperative radiographs were taken at 1 day to measure the parameters of acetabular index(AI),acetabular index of depth(AID),acetabular index of width(AIW),And postoperative radiographs were taken at 1 days to measure the parameters of AI,AID,AIW,lateral rotation angle(LRA).compare AI,AIW,AID before and after surgery.The difference values of the data with significant difference results were calvulated before and after surgery.The relationship between the difference values of the data and LRA was analyzed.Based on the relationship between the difference values of shifting and LRA,the scatter diagram was made,Using LRA as dependent variable and difference values of AI as independent variable to make univariate linear regression.In order to study the relationship between age and the LRA.We use LRA as dependent variable and age as independent variable to makeunivariate linear regression.In order to analyze the effect of sexual distinction on the LRA.We divided the patient samples into the male and the female groups,using the t-test to analysis of difference of the LRA in two groups.In order to analyze the difference between the lift and the right of LRA,we divided them into the left group and the right group,using the t-test to analysis of difference of the LRA in two groups.Results:The difference of AI between before and after surgery have statistical significance(P<0.05).There is no statistical difference of AIW between before and after surgery(P>0.05).There is no statistical difference of AID between before and after surgery(P>0.05).The difference values of the data of AI has linear correlation with LRA(P< 0.01).There was a positive correlation between the age and the LRA(P<0.05).There was no significant difference between the male group and the female group(P > 0.05),and there was no significant difference between the left group and the right group(P > 0.05).Conclusion:The LRA is affected by age and there is a positive correlation between the age and the LRA(P<0.05).but not affected by sex,left or right.after salter innominate osteotomy(SIO).It suggests that the older the children,the greater the LRA during the operation.The difference values of the data of AI has correlation with LRA after salter innominate osteotomy(SIO),but it did not affect of AID and AIW.It suggests that the direction of the acetabulum have changed effectively after salter innominate osteotomy(SIO).But salter innominate osteotomy(SIO)can not change the AID and AIW.The downward movement of the distal iliac end is the main reason affecting the downward rotation of the acetabulum and the change of the slope of the top of the acetabulum.
